The fmu2aadl script maps FMU to AADL package that can be later
integrated into larger AADL models, to simulate larger systems, and
additional makefiles and C compilation units for integration with
Ocarina.
This package embeds a copy of the FMUSDK2.0.3 ported to Linux by Christopher Brooks from https://github.com/cxbrooks/fmusdk2
The script is provided as a standard Python module.
The script can be installed, as user, using default Python install procedure. From the repository root directory, simply run:
python setup.py install --user
Do not forget to add $HOME/.local/bin to your PATH.
The script assumes libxml2 is installed, along with a fully
operational Ocarina, Python and a gcc + binutils compilation chain.
See provided Dockerfile for the full list of dependencies.
Examples are provided in the examples directory.
A Dockerfile is provided for quick tests using the docker container engine.
See contents for more details.
